Forum: Who Speaks for Public Lands?

June 15, 2016 @ 6:00 pm - 7:30 pm UTC-7

Free

FREE public event, no RSVP required.

A debate is brewing over America’s public lands, and we want you to be a part of the discussion. Join us for A Future of the Colorado Plateau Forum Special Event, “Who Speaks for Public Lands?” on June 15th to hear a lively conversation on the future of our national inheritance.

Panelists:

Paul Larmer – Executive Director, High Country News
Jim Enote – Director, A:shiwi A:wan Museum & Heritage Center, Zuni, New Mexico
Sarah Krakoff – Professor of Law, University of Colorado Boulder
Kieran Suckling – Executive Director, Center for Biological Diversity

Moderator:

Bill Hedden –Executive Director, Grand Canyon Trust
